After the prologue that introduces the night' watch, the book starts at Winterfell with King Robert and the royal family coming to the Starks. The book ends with Daenerys holding three dragons in her arms after burning a funeral pyre for her husband. The book follows the adventures of Ned Stark, Tyrion Lannister, Catelyn Stark, Daenerys Targaryen, Sansa Stark, Arya Stark, and Jon Snow. The book is primarily concerned with Ned Stark's investigation into the reason why Jon Arryn, former hand of the king, had possibly been killed, the development of Daenerys, her wedding, maturation, freedom from her brother Viserys, and her eventual freedom from her Dothraki husband, and the development of Jon Snow.
